A leading design engineering consultancy is seeking an experienced M&E Project Engineer to join their team in the South Leeds/Wakefield area. The role involves working on a variety of commercial, retail, and industrial projects within a dynamic team. Offering a competitive salary up to around £50,000, this is a fantastic opportunity to contribute to innovative low energy designs and projects in a well-established firm.

How to prepare for a job interview at Konker Recruitment
✨Know Your Projects
Before the interview, brush up on your past projects, especially those related to retail and industrial sectors. Be ready to discuss specific challenges you faced and how you overcame them, as this will show your practical experience and problem-solving skills.
✨Understand Low Energy Designs
Since the role focuses on innovative low energy designs, make sure you’re familiar with the latest trends and technologies in this area. Prepare to discuss how you can contribute to these projects and any relevant experience you have in implementing sustainable solutions.
✨Team Dynamics Matter
This position involves working within a dynamic team, so be prepared to talk about your teamwork experiences. Share examples of how you’ve collaborated with others, resolved conflicts, or contributed to a positive team environment, as this will highlight your interpersonal skills.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ions that show your interest in the company and the role. Inquire about their current projects, team structure, or future goals regarding sustainability. This not only demonstrates your enthusiasm but also helps you gauge if the company is the right fit for you.
